Background
The carrier is logistics carrying equipment which has the function of carrying goods, when the manual pallet carrier is used at a carrying station, the pallet fork carried by the manual pallet carrier is inserted into the pallet hole, the manual hydraulic system is driven by manpower to realize the lifting and descending of pallet goods, the carrying operation is completed by manpower pulling, and the manual pallet carrier is the simplest, most effective and most common loading and unloading and carrying tool in pallet transport tools of the carrying station.
At present, when the existing laminated carrier for transportation is used, because the appearance of goods is irregular, the stacking times are not too high, the goods need to be carried for many times by personnel, and the carrying efficiency is reduced, so that the novel laminated carrier for transportation is provided at present.
